Search a number
-
+
112344421504 = 277217912057
BaseRepresentation
bin110100010100000111…
…1111101010010000000
3101201222110211221002011
41220220033331102000
53320040132442004
6123335454502304
711054666553400
oct1505017752200
9351873757064
10112344421504
1143710551747
1219933b04994
13a795126273
14561a6d6800
152dc7d41004
hex1a283fd480

112344421504 has 48 divisors (see below), whose sum is σ = 260351763030. Its totient is φ = 48147606528.

The previous prime is 112344421493. The next prime is 112344421523. The reversal of 112344421504 is 405124443211.

It is a happy number.

It can be written as a sum of positive squares in only one way, i.e., 106772097600 + 5572323904 = 326760^2 + 74648^2 .

It is an unprimeable number.

It is a polite number, since it can be written in 5 ways as a sum of consecutive naturals, for example, 8949757 + ... + 8962300.

Almost surely, 2112344421504 is an apocalyptic number.

112344421504 is a gapful number since it is divisible by the number (14) formed by its first and last digit.

It is an amenable number.

112344421504 is an abundant number, since it is smaller than the sum of its proper divisors (148007341526).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

112344421504 is an equidigital number, since it uses as much as digits as its factorization.

112344421504 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 17912085 (or 17912066 counting only the distinct ones).

The product of its (nonzero) digits is 15360, while the sum is 31.

Adding to 112344421504 its reverse (405124443211), we get a palindrome (517468864715).

The spelling of 112344421504 in words is "one hundred twelve billion, three hundred forty-four million, four hundred twenty-one thousand, five hundred four".

Divisors: 1 2 4 7 8 14 16 28 32 49 56 64 98 112 128 196 224 392 448 784 896 1568 3136 6272 17912057 35824114 71648228 125384399 143296456 250768798 286592912 501537596 573185824 877690793 1003075192 1146371648 1755381586 2006150384 2292743296 3510763172 4012300768 7021526344 8024601536 14043052688 16049203072 28086105376 56172210752 112344421504